  • Our Payments/Fintech organization owns delivery and operations for the parts of our product that accept and process payments on our point-of-sale, as well as building out financial services on top of that platform.
  • On behalf of our customers, we process billions of dollars in payments per year; we’re a critical part of their businesses, as well as Toast’s.
  • As an Engineering Manager, you will be responsible for the success of anywhere from one to three teams.
  • Their success is defined by delivering on work to enhance our product offerings, communicating the impact effectively, and increasing effectiveness/efficiency over time.
  • You will use your empathetic people management skills, detail-oriented project management skills, and your technical background to guide teams to success and to grow your team members into effective, compassionate engineers that exceed expectations in their individual roles.

About this roll* (Responsibilities)

  • Growing and developing individuals on your teams through tactics such as regular 1:1s, finding creative opportunities to challenge them beyond their perceived limits, direct coaching and team coaching
  • Assess the health of your teams through reviewing metrics and attending team meetings
  • Re-factor engineering teams (and support hiring efforts) in order to meet changing business needs and needs of individuals
  • Review code changes and design documents to guide the technical direction as needed
  • Work with your peers to support the strategic efforts and solve the problems of the overall engineering organization. Past efforts have included:
    • Defining and streamlining cross team communication patterns
    • Coordinating the engineering wide co-op and intern program
    • Leading a manager-to-manager peer discussion group
